Why did the United States enter World War I?

- Because Germany attacked U.S. (civilian) ships
- To support the Allied Powers (England, France, Italy, and Russia)
- To oppose the Central Powers (Germany, Austria-Hungary, the Ottoman Empire, and Bulgaria)

German submarine attacks on ships carrying Americans helped bring the United States into World War I in 1917. The United States joined the Allied Powers against Germany and the other Central Powers.
